K1 is not the Crystal everyone expects. We chose it anyway, and on purpose.

I The Expectation

K1 is the right glass for this watch. Sapphire is the better spec, not the better fit.

Sapphire is harder, and it’s the line people like to see printed on a box. I’ll use it on the watch that calls for it. But a spec sheet doesn’t decide what a watch needs, and this one needed K1. The shape wants toughness over hardness, and K1 keeps its edges clean where sapphire’s stronger bend would distort a curve this deep.

II The Impact

There’s a practical side, too. K1 can take the hits.

The crystal sits proud, rising above the case edge instead of tucking inside it, so it’s the first thing to meet a table or a doorframe. Hard and tough aren’t the same thing: sheer hardness can crack or shatter under a sharp knock, while K1 takes that hit and shrugs it off. It’s the logic that kept a soft, shatter-resistant crystal on the first watch worn on the moon: Omega offered to upgrade it to sapphire, and NASA said no. When a crystal is this exposed, surviving the knock beats winning a scratch test.

III The Shape

It also shapes better.

K1 curves into a deep dome cleanly, with even thickness and tight distortion control. Its refractive index is low, about 1.52, so it bends light gently and the curve stays flat to read, edge to edge. Harder, more expensive glass sits near 1.77.
Reflection we handled head-on, with four layers of anti-reflective coating to keep glare off the glass.

That beautiful curved edge is simply easier to get right.

IV The Budget

And the budget choice was deliberate, not a cut.

Spending less on the glass let me put more where the eye and the hand actually live: dial printing, lume, case finishing, hand machining and different dial finishes.

The money goes into what you see and feel.

V The Feeling

The part I didn’t plan on.

What I didn’t know was that K1 is warm, soft, and more analog. It reads like a watchmaker’s tool, not a showroom object.

For a watch rooted in mid-century chronographs, that warmth isn’t a compromise. It’s the whole feeling I was after.
